Detective Chief Inspector Jim Taggart is a tough, sarcastic copper who has come up the hard way in the Maryhill Police Department. When he's out to solve a murder, he uses whatever means he must to catch the killer ' and he never gives up the chase. Set in Scotland's largest city, Glasgow's often mean, gritty streets are witness to many gruesome and inflammatory crimes. With its grisly details and complex plots, you will witness why Taggart has become the longest running police detective drama on British television.
Prayer for the Dead ' When his boss has a heart attack and Taggart is promoted to Acting Superintendent, he begins to worry that Jardine and Reid might not be capable of solving the recent murders of two young girls. This episode is Mark McManus' final appearance as Jim Taggart.
Black Orchid ' The 'Great Sabina' hypnotizes a woman into believing that she can swim. When she is found drowned, Sabina's show career is finished and he vows revenge on those who ruined him. This is Harriet Buchan's final appearance as Jean Taggart and Colin McCredie joins the cast as DC Stuart Fraser.

Del Toro to direct The Hobbit
Del Toro will move to New Zealand for the next four years to work with Jackson and his Wingnut and WETA production teams. He will helm the two films back to back – telling the story of “The Hobbit,” and its sequel, which will deal with the 60-year period between “The Hobbit” and “The Fellowship of the Ring,” the first of the “Lord of the Rings” trilogy.
